Report: Michael Laudrup eager to sign John Terry

Chelsea captain John Terry is reportedly a transfer target of Michael Laudrup, who recently took charge of Qatari club Lekhwiya.

Michael Laudrup has reportedly made John Terry one of his main transfer targets at Lekhwiya.

Former Swansea City manager Laudrup, who left the Liberty Stadium last season, was confirmed as the Qatari club's new boss last week.

The Dane has already identified Terry as a key player to bolster his squad, despite the fact that the Chelsea skipper only recently extended his contract at Stamford Bridge, according to the Daily Star.

The 33-year-old is expected to resist the temptation of a lucrative switch to the Middle East this time around, but the report added that he could be lured there once his deal with the Blues expires next summer.

Laudrup's Lekhwiya were only founded in 2009, yet they have already won the Qatar Stars League three times.
